Research Databases for Theater

To find a magazine or journal by a known title, use our ECSU Journal Locator.

Theater-specific Databases
Theatre in Video A resource that includes streaming video of 250 complete performances of classic plays, as well as 100 documentaries relating to these works.

General Databases (which include information on theater)
AcademicSearch Premier (EbscoHost) An interdisciplinary database which covers the humanities, and includes full-text articles to over 4,595 periodicals.
American National Biography Contains biographies of almost 18,000 deceased men and women, whose lives have shaped America. Search theater personalities by choosing "Occupations" - "Performing Arts".
Arts & Humanities Search Access to bibliographic information and citation references from leading arts and humanities journals.
Encyclopedia Britannica Online version of the familiar work. A good source for general theater research.
iCONN Newsstand A collection of 6 major newspaper titles including the New York Times, the L.A. Times, the Wall Street Journal, the Washington Post, the Christian Science Monitor, and the Hartford Courant. Newspapers include reviews of theater productions.
In the First Person An index to English language personal narratives allowing users to perform in-depth field and keyword searches across all letters, diaries, oral histories, memoirs, and autobiographies within scholarly materials that are freely available on the Web and Alexander Street databases. Includes various comments about theater personalities.
JSTOR

JSTOR is an archive of core scholarly journals in cross-disciplinary fields such as anthropology, economics, mathematics, and the arts and sciences. Our collection includes Arts & Sciences I & II collections, which are searched from the initial JSTOR search box seamlessly.


Project Muse Full-text access to over 300 scholarly journals in history and the humanities.
Subject Specific Databases (which cross-over into theater topics)
Contemporary Authors
Contains biographical and bibliographic information on approximately 112,000 American and international authors, including modern novelists, poets, playwrights, nonfiction writers, journalists and scriptwriters. (Choose tab for "Contemporary Authors".)
Contemporary Literary Criticism
A collection of critical essays about the works of more than 600 significant American and international authors, as well as their biographical information. (Choose tab for "Contemporary Literary Criticism".)
Grove Dictionary of Art
A good source for information on architectural details and ornament, costumes and interior design.
Humanities International Index

Covers indexing and abstracting for over 2,000 journals in the humanities.


MLA International Bibliography
An index to critical scholarship on literature, language, linguistics and folklore. Coverage from 1963-current. A good source for play criticism, and bio-critical articles on playwrights.
